HU soccermen draw with Goshen
Sunday, October 8, 2017 11:43 AM
The Huntington University men’s soccer team scored one early, visiting Goshen scored one late and that’s the way it ended, 1-1, after two overtimes on Saturday afternoon, Oct. 7.
The Foresters hit back netting at 14:44 when Matheus Louzada scored off a Luke Unger pass. Goshen matched the tally at the 68:12 mark, and neither team was able to make the scoreboard change after that.
HU moves to 5-2-4 overall, 1-0-2 in Crossroads League play.
Senior Troy Hester made five saves on the afternoon.
The Foresters put seven shots on net.
